In a move set to provide Managed Service Providers (MSPs) with a more robust security solution, leading Managed Detection and Response (MDR) provider Blackpoint has announced a partnership with SentinelOne, a major player in autonomous endpoint security. The collaboration aims to give MSPs an enhanced, more unified cybersecurity offering to combat today's increasingly sophisticated threats.

The alliance is designed to integrate Blackpoint's human-led Security Operations Center (SOC) and proactive threat hunting capabilities with SentinelOne's AI-powered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) technology.
For many MSPs, managing security alerts across numerous clients and platforms can be a significant challenge. This partnership provides a powerful solution by offloading the workload of threat investigation and response to a dedicated team of experts.

The integration with SentinelOne's platform means that Blackpoint's CompassOne platform will automatically ingest security data from SentinelOne-protected endpoints. This allows Blackpoint's analysts to cut through the noise of routine alerts, focus on legitimate threats, and take immediate action.
Key benefits for MSPs and their clients include:
24/7 human-led response: Blackpoint's SOC will continuously monitor SentinelOne alerts. If a threat is detected, the analysts can respond immediately, neutralizing the threat by terminating processes, isolating endpoints, and conducting root cause analysis.
Reduced overhead: The partnership eliminates the need for MSPs to spend significant time and resources managing SentinelOne alerts, allowing them to focus on strategic tasks and business growth.
Enhanced visibility: The integration will provide MSPs with a more holistic view of their clients' security posture, combining endpoint data with Blackpoint's own security insights.
This collaboration is part of a broader trend in the cybersecurity industry where specialized vendors are partnering to create more comprehensive and effective solutions, particularly for the small to medium-sized business (SMB) market that relies heavily on MSPs for IT and security.
By combining the strengths of an EDR tool with a full-service MDR offering, the partnership aims to provide an "enterprise-grade" level of protection that is both accessible and manageable for MSPs and their clients.
